Computationally efficient fully-automatic online neural spike detection and sorting in presence of multi-unit activity for implantable circuits
Abstract: Highlights•A fully-automatic neural spike sorting system for future hardware implementation.•An automatic detection threshold technique that improves detection significantly ( > 15%).•Higher-order energy operators are better for multi-unit activity detection.•A newly introduced feature that is able to distinguish multi-unit activity from single-unit.•The system is computationally very efficient.
